This E3 2015 preview trailer for Rise of the Tomb Raider features Lady Croft scaling a snowy mountainside in the hopes of finding something shiny.

Xbox's E3 preview cinematic for Rise of the Tomb Raider is meant to remind us why Lara Croft is willing to charge headfirst into death-defying scenarios. This trailer recalls famous explorers of the past, such as the aviation pioneer Amelia Earhart, to remind us of some of Lara Croft's inspirations. The video starts off with Lara climbing the frigid side of a mountain in the midst of a blizzard. After Lara survives an avalanche (thanks to her two climbing axes), she reaches the summit of the mountain. At the mountaintop, Lara finds the doorway to what is presumably an ancient tomb that she's going to explore. The sequel to the awesome 2013 Tomb Raider reboot will put tomb exploration and puzzle-solving gameplay in the spotlight. This is meant to help cater to fans of the original PS-One Tomb Raider series. Rise of the Tomb Raider will still obviously have tons of action, but it will shift gears to focus on surviving in the wild, exploration, tomb investigation and puzzle solving.

Rise of the Tomb Raider is set for a holiday 2015 launch for Xbox One and Xbox 360. Due to a timed exclusivity deal with Xbox, we have a feeling Lara Croft's next adventure won't hit the PlayStation 4, PlayStation 3 and PC until well into 2016.
